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

[TuT] Edytowanie RespóW MetinóW


Rekomendowane odpowiedzi

Opublikowano

Miało nie być, ale w końcu poniedziałek dzień dziwny.

http://www.youtube.com/watch?v=MVYIT4RciJg

Więc sposób na zmianę respów metinów jest prosty.

W pliku group.txt są grupy z mobami, a w tabeli mob_proto w bazie danych player w polach attack_speed i move_speed są numery tych grup podane, żeby wylatywały moby.

Wiem, że strasznie prosto i niezawile to napisałem, ale może dalsza część będzie prostsza w zrozumieniu.

Więc tak:

 

Przykład

Bierzemy sobie wpis metka, np. 8023.

Pola attack_speed i move_speed ustawiamy tak:

pma.png

Mamy 2 numerki - 9528 i 9529.

Bierzemy plik group.txt, znajdujący się w share_data; czyli np.:

/home/game/share_data/locale/hongkong/group.txt

Idziemy na koniec pliku i dopisujemy te grupy:

Group Lucznicy
{
 Vnum 9528
 Leader 1071 1062
 1 1071 1061
 2 1071 1061
 3 1067 1061
 4 1067 1061
 5 101 1067
 6 101 1067
 7 101 1067
 8 101 1071
 9 101 1071

}
Group Reszta
{
 Vnum 9529
 Leader 1032 1067
 1 1032 1067
 2 1032 1067
 3 1032 1067
 4 1032 1067
 5 1068 1066
 6 101 1067
 7 101 1067
 8 101 1067
 9 101 1069
 10 101 1069
 11 101 1069
 12 101 1066


}

 

 

Która liczba za co odpowiada?

Przykład:

 

 

Group MetekDemce <--- nazwa grupy, dowolna

{

Vnum 9531 <-- vnum grupy wpisywany w mob_proto, musi być unikalny, więc warto przeszukać plik, czy się nie powtarza(Ctrl+F)

Leader 1032 9530 <--- Drugą liczbą jest vnum "lidera" grupy mobów, pierwsza liczba dowolna

1 101 9530 <--- Druga liczba vnum moba jakiego chcemy mieć w grupie, pierwsza liczba dowolna, nie jest brana pod uwagę

2 101 9529 reszta mobów...

3 101 9529

4 101 9528

5 101 9528

6 101 9530

7 101 9530

8 101 9530

9 101 9529

10 101 9529

11 101 9528

12 101 9528

13 101 9529

14 101 9529

15 101 9529

16 101 9529

17 101 9529

18 101 9529

19 101 9530

20 101 9530

21 101 9530

}

 

 

Więc w skrócie:

w pliku group.txt dodajemy grupę o dowolnej nazwie i dowolnym vnumie(lecz musi być on unikalny, nie może występować wcześniej w tym pliku, sprawdzamy to najprościej przez Ctrl+F i wpisanie vnuma którego chcemy użyć, jak nie będzie grupy o takim vnumie to jest okej)

Ustawiamy w niej lidera, dodajemy moby. Zapisujemy plik.

Wybranemu metinowi, którego respy chcemy zmienić, zmieniamy pola move_speed i attack_speed w tabeli mob_proto wpisując w tych polach vnumy DWÓCH grup, przykład:

pma.png

 

Co jeszcze? Ano to, że zamiast vnuma moba można wpisać vnum innej grupy, np.:

Group Reszta

{

Vnum 9529

Leader 1032 1067

1 1032 1067

2 1032 1067

3 1032 1067

4 1032 1067

5 1068 1066

6 101 1067

7 101 1067

8 101 1067

9 101 1069

10 101 1069

11 101 1069

12 101 1066

 

 

}

Group Koncowka

{

Vnum 9530

Leader 1032 1038

1 101 1061

2 101 1061

3 101 1063

4 101 1063

5 101 1064

6 101 1064

7 101 1038

8 101 1038

9 101 1038

10 101 1068

11 101 1068

12 101 1068

13 101 9529 <---- w tym miejscu podaję vnum innej grupy, a nie moba

}

Dla opornych kilka grup, które możecie wrzucić do pliku i wykorzystać je później w metinach:

http://wklej.org/id/437337/

 

Dodam, że po zmianie pliku group.txt wymagany jest restart game'a - najprościej to zrobić poprzez zabicie procesu danego kanału(tj. w konsoli "top" znajdujemy PID kanału, zamykamy top'a i wpisujemy kill [tutaj pid kanału] np. kill 6336), lub po prostu możemy wyłączyć serwer i włączyć go ponownie.

Sposób przetestowany i działa; poradnik nie jest tłumaczeniem, napisałem go w całości samemu, a sposób edycji respów metinów znalazłem bodajże na cheatforge.net; lub na pvpersach - nie pamiętam, dawno to było.

Specjalista
Opublikowano

Jeszcze tego tuta nie widzialem na MPC ;)

Nikt nie chcial go udostepnic xD Teraz bd pisac w postach usun ten temat usun pare serwerow takie cos ma...

1365526782-U231645.png


Opublikowano

A jednak napisałeś ;)

Dostaniesz kolejne plusy i jeszcze raz dzięki, muszę w końcu się zabrać do roboty i napisać programy do edycji tego typu plików :)

Opublikowano

@2xUP

Wiem, że taki by się przydał, jak będę miał trochę więcej czasu to postaram się zrobić :)

Opublikowano

Axor, milo by bylo jakbys zrobil do edytowania pliku z dropem itemków =)

Oj boże już nie róbcie sobie syfu tymi ciągłymi programami, ja osobiście używam gamefilesopen a w sumie zabawa z serwerem kosztuje mnie jakies 80gb pamięci.

Wiem że programy te ważą bardzo mało, ale często gubię się w moich pracach, a jakbym miał jeszcze szukać programy to ....

FileZilla, putty, gamefilesopen, notepad i notatnik, pracując przeważnie te wszystkie programy mam otwarte i naprawdę nie brakuje mi tutaj programiku dodającego drop...

Broń Boże nie obrażam tutaj autora bo odwala kawał dobrej roboty na mpc, ale ludzie prosicie o same gotowce czy też programy robiące wszystko za Was zamiast samemu zacząć się rozwijać....

02758850976702993171.png
Opublikowano

Bo tak wygodniej :P

 

@2x UP

 

Tu chodzi o to, żeby nie bawić się całą noc z tym wszystkim, tylko kilka minut i mieć zrobione!

 

Tyle na ten temat, co do topicu, tzn do autora się zwracam teraz.

Może zrobiłbyś tutka jak dodać dodatkowe piętro w dt ? (wiem, że to questy ale tak czy siak się na tym nie znam...)

=)

Opublikowano

@3xUP

Masz trochę racji, niektórych programów wcale nie używam, ale na MPC wchodzi dużo niedoświadczonych osób, którym takie programy ułatwiają życie :)

 

@2xUP

Bo lubimy, bo dobry temat, bo tak wyszło itp. :D

 

@UP

Też by mi się przydały nowe piętra w DT ;)

Opublikowano

Przecież w DT macie od groma gotowców, wzorujcie się na innych piętrach, ale w sumie to nie miejsce na rozmowy o DT, załóżcie sobie nowy temat, czy coś<:

  • 2 tygodnie później...
Opublikowano

+ dla Ciebie :)Bardzo ładnie opisane :)

Tylko Ciekawi mnie jedno,

jak dodam na końcu tą grupe w 13 to będzie znaczyło że jeszcze się będą moby z tamtej grupy respiły ?;>

47a2cebcf2f4df95.png

  • 2 tygodnie później...
  • 2 tygodnie później...

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...